CHE Behavioral Health Services is seeking a Psychiatrist (MD/DO) to serve as a Collaborating Physician for our psychiatric nurse practitioners and physician assistants. CHE is a premier behavioral health provider with 700+ clinicians across 11 states, delivering high-quality, compliant, and patient-centered care in skilled nursing facilities and outpatient settings.

Position Overview

The Collaborating Physician provides clinical oversight to CHE psychiatric NPs/PAs by reviewing charts, ensuring adherence to best-practice guidelines, and supporting diagnostic and treatment accuracy. This role is fully collaborative-no direct patient care required. CHE's State and Regional Directors provide day-to-day operational support for NPs and PAs.

Key Responsibilities
• Review and approve medical records as required by state law
• Provide clinical consultation to NPs/PAs as needed
• Support accurate psychiatric evaluation, diagnosis, and treatment planning
• Ensure prescribing practices align with APA and SAMHSA guidelines
• Participate in periodic quality review meetings

Requirements
• MD or DO with Board Certification in Psychiatry
• Must reside in New York and hold active NY license
• Active DEA
• Commitment to quality, compliance, and collaborative care
